MPPS YerraPally: A Rural Primary School in Telangana, India

MPPS YerraPally, a primary school nestled in the rural heart of Telangana, India, stands as a testament to the commitment to education in underserved communities. Established in 1969, this co-educational institution, managed by the local body, provides crucial primary education to children in the Gadwal block of Mahbubnagar district. The school's dedication to learning is evident in its well-maintained facilities and committed teaching staff.

The school building, a government structure, houses three classrooms, each designed to foster a conducive learning environment. These classrooms are supplemented by additional rooms designated for non-teaching activities and a dedicated space for the school's teachers and headmaster. While lacking a boundary wall, the school boasts essential amenities such as electricity, a functional playground, and a library stocked with 360 books – a valuable resource for expanding the students' horizons beyond the classroom.

Catering to students from Class 1 to Class 5, MPPS YerraPally employs a dedicated team of three teachers: one male and two female educators. Telugu serves as the primary language of instruction, ensuring that students receive education in their mother tongue. The school's commitment to the well-being of its students extends to providing midday meals, prepared and served on the school premises, ensuring that no child faces the burden of hunger while pursuing their education.

The school's location in a rural setting presents unique challenges, but its accessibility via an all-weather road helps overcome logistical hurdles. The school year commences in April, aligning with the regional academic calendar.
